As a legacy I decided to include some of the history of the good old =
days to comment the birth of Softimage|DS:

-PS: the geek factor of the following text may offend some users, be =
warned :-)-

=20

Back in the 1990, lots of the post-production crowd in Montreal was =
laughing about the initial vision of Daniel Langlois.

The motto from Softimage was roughly -A fully integrated editing and =
finishing product running on a personal PC-

At that time some prototype running on SGI hardware was shown to key =
people in the industry.

But Digital Studio was more of a concept than a tactile product.

=20

Personally at that time I was one of those online editors sweating over =
a GVG 200 switcher, Kaleidoscope 2 channels, Chyron Scribe and a GVG-151 =
connected to an armada of VCR.

I was then scratching my forehead and thinking: "They're must be a more =
elegant way to do all this stuff..."=20

=20

I often share my thought with my pears, thanks to Edith G-P, Christine =
D. and Eric L. for their tremendous patience for listening to my mental =
monologue.

After a salary argument with my director at that time I decided that I =
was ready for a radical change. (Many thanks to Bernard Bergeron for =
pushing my name to Softimage.)

So from the luxurious on-line room filled with clients eating St-Hubert =
BBQ chicken in my back (poutine not included), I then moved to a =
minuscule green cubicle at the Museum Just for Laugh on St-Laurent =
Street :-)

=20

At that time the efforts to integrate the PLAY hardware in DS wasn't =
very successful, we then switch to the Matrox Digisuite/Genie =
3D/Netpower platform.

We were very close to ship and we even get in Beta process with this =
configuration, but even with a computer that was the size of a mini-bar =
and filled with every video PCI/ISA cards available on the universe

the performance and stability were simply not present at the rendezvous.

=20

Hopefully a brilliant team of program and hardware engineer based in =
Alabama working for a company called Intergraph had the solution in =
their pocket.

A long vertical cabinet filled with Dual 233Mhz CPU (code-named =
Stingray) bundle with: a SDI capture card (Studio-Z) connected to 4 x 9G =
internal SCSI drives.

This hardware configuration provide up 30 minutes of SD un-compress =
video...

=20

Oui Monsieur !=20

The long waited Digital Studio was finally available to the market.

At NAB 1998 the most major breakthrough for Softimage DS was about to be =
introduced...

=20

A new powerful CPU equipped with dual PIII400 Mhz (GT1) attached to a =
Fiber Channel Storage of 8 x 9G drive was introduced to NAB 1998.

This was backed by a killer DS demo executed by Dean Lewis in the main =
theater.

=20

I was totally amazed seeing two stream of un-compress video running =
real-time without dropping frame with real-time chromakeyer and =
transitions.

Nice work from everyone from Softimage and Intergraph, a true synergy =
between the hardware and the software.

=20

In the mean time Symphony (the long awaited un-compress solution from =
Avid ) was introduced to NAB 1998.

At that time Avid was using the exact same platform than Softimage DS, =
the same purple box:

The trusty GT1...on the other hand the hardware and software from Avid =
Symphony was quite different and not as performing as well compare to =
Softimage|DS.
